Studies indicate that nicotine and cigarette smoke exposure significantly stunt physical growth, particularly in children and adolescents, by interfering with bone development and decreasing growth plate efficiency. Nicotine restricts growth by reducing blood flow, inducing nutrient deficiencies, and inhibiting chondrocyte differentiation in bones.

Key Findings on Nicotine and Growth
Skeletal Development: Nicotine directly impacts growth plate chondrocytes, suppressing their ability to divide and develop, which delays overall skeletal growth.
Prenatal/Early Life Exposure: Children of mothers who smoke (specifically 10+ cigarettes/day) are significantly shorter—up to 0.65cm—than children of non-smokers.
Secondary Effects: Nicotine suppresses appetite, which can lead to reduced nutritional intake necessary for growth.
Secondhand Smoke: Exposure to secondhand smoke significantly increases the risk of stunted growth, with risks rising with higher daily exposure.
Dose-Response Relationship: Studies suggest a, clear, dose-response relationship between the amount of smoke exposure and the degree of growth restriction, particularly in height.
